我将如何使用(实时运行的)MongoDB开发另一个 meteor 应用程序?我尝试在运行.meteor/server/server.js
之前修改(MONGO_URL
)并指定meteor
无效。
这无需使用 bundle 的MongoDB,它必须是单独的/自定义的(基本上是另一个 meteor 实例)。
这可以通过deploy method完成,但是在开发过程中正常的meteor run
呢?
更新:这确实有效,但是客户端实现似乎有点故障
最佳答案
如Unofficial Meteor FAQ中所述,您可以在MONGO_URL
环境变量设置为所需实例的情况下调用Meteor:
MONGO_URL=mongodb://localhost:27017 meteor
如果您的MongoDB处理多个数据库,则可以通过将其附加到URL来指示要使用的数据库:
MONGO_URL=mongodb://localhost:27017/mydb meteor
您甚至可以通过运行以下命令阻止Meteor在开发中启动本地Mongo实例:
MONGO_URL=none meteor